Open Internet Explorer. Click Tools icon. | Internet Options. Click the Advanced tab. Under “Security”, deselect the following: Check for publisher's certificate revocation. Check for server certificate revocation. Click Apply. Click Ok. Close and relaunch Internet Explorer.
Select Internet Options from the menu. Navigate to Advanced tab. Scroll down to Security section, locate Warn about certificate address mismatch option and uncheck it. Click Apply and OK and restart your computer.
The There is a problem with this website's security certificate error may occur due to the enabled Warn about certificate address mismatch option. To check that and disable this option, you have to: Right-click Windows key and open Control Panel. Select Internet Options and open Advanced tab.
A site's certificate allows Internet Explorer to establish a secure connection with the site. Certificate errors occur when there's a problem with a certificate or a web server's use of the certificate. ... This often means that the security certificate was obtained or used fraudulently by the website.
Open Internet Explorer. Select the options gear, then select Internet Options. Select the Advanced tab. Scroll down to the Security section, and uncheck to Warn about certificate address mismatch option. Select OK. Restart the computer.
Open Internet Explorer and click on “Tools,” or the gear icon. Click “Internet Options” and click on the “Advanced” tab. Navigate to the “Security” subheading and remove the check marks on both the Check for publisher's certificate revocation and check for server certificate revocation options.
Well, the error often occurs due to the wrong date on your computer. As security certificate comes with a valid duration the wrong date set up on your computer can be the reason for this error. You may get a message for security certificate errors while you are browsing a particular site.
In Windows Internet Explorer, click Continue to this website (not recommended). A red Address Bar and a certificate warning appear. Click the Certificate Error button to open the information window. Click View Certificates, and then click Install Certificate.
1. Open Google Chrome and go to Settings. 2. Scroll down to bottom and click on Show advanced settings. 3. Now scroll till you find Change proxy settings under network and click it. 4. Go to Content tab and click on Clear SSL state.
